Soreide Law Group has filed a FINRA arbitration against:  

NETWORK 1 FINANCIAL SECURITIES, INC (Respondent)  

The Claimant (our client) resides in Pennsylvania. The lawsuit states that in 2019, the Claimant received a cold call from Charles Vincent Malico, who has been a registered representative of NETWORK 1 FINANCIAL SECURITIES since 2016.  Malico is not named in the lawsuit.  

According to the lawsuit, the Claimant was looking for growth and he spoke to Malico frequently by phone. According to the lawsuit, in the short time that the Claimant had been doing business with NETWORK 1 FINANCIAL SECURITIES and Malico, it’s alleged that 297 trades were placed in 237 business days for a total of $39,149 in commission and fees since January 2021 alone.

The lawsuit alleges the Claimant’s account was on margin and placed in small and micro cap stocks. In 2021, the Claimant lost approximately $65,000 while NETWORK 1 FINANCIAL SECURITIES and their registered representative, profited approximately $40,000 in commission and interest, according to the lawsuit.

The lawsuit claims that the Claimant has suffered losses of approximately $65,000.00, and is claiming: negligence, breach of fiduciary duty, and negligent supervision.    

According to FINRA’s BrokerCheck, available to the public on FINRA’s website, Charles Vincent Malico has been in the securities industry for 34 years and has been with 21 firms. Five of those firms have been expelled from the securities industry by FINRA. Malico has 9 disclosures on his FINRA CRD report, 6 of the disclosures are “Customer Disputes.”

The significance of Malico’s 6 reported customer complaints is underscored in FINRA’s NOTICE to MEMBERS 03-49. FINRA conducted a review of the CRD’s of all registered representatives, only .41% had been the subject of 3 or more customer complaints.  In other words, Malico’s customer complaints rank him in the top one-hundredth percent of all registered representatives for customer complaints.
